Datasheets like the Sg220 Datasheet are used in a variety of critical phases. For product development, they inform design decisions, helping engineers select the right components for their needs. During the manufacturing process, they ensure that the Sg220 is handled, tested, and assembled correctly. For troubleshooting, the datasheet provides a reference point for diagnosing issues and understanding expected performance. Key information typically found includes:

  • Electrical characteristics (e.g., voltage, current, power consumption)
  • Mechanical dimensions and pinouts
  • Operating temperature ranges
  • Performance metrics and tolerances
  • Application notes and recommended usage guidelines
